==Zsnes problems=='''ZSNES''' is a free and open-source [[Super Nintendo emulators|Super Famicom (SNES) emulator]] written in [[wikipedia:x86|x86]] assembly. It was originally made in 1997 and was one of the most popular Super Nintendo emulators from late nineties to mid-2000s, but now is obsolete and has not been updated since 2007. Currently the only reason to use ZSNES is for the netplay or if you're on a toaster.

The current version (v1.51) created more problems than it fixed and many problems still remain:[[File:Kirby3-forest.gif|frame|SNES Pseudo Hi-Res translucency on ''new'' graphics engine]]* Compatibility is lower than any modern emulatoremulators due to low accuracy to real SNES system. * Games crashing: Der Langrisser (freezes after 2–3 hours), Super Mario RPG (freezes in many different points of the game), Star Ocean and many other games have freezing and crashing issues. * Bad sound emulation: Many games sound inaccurate on ZSNES. ZSNES's audio timer isn't floating point so there are timing artifacts in the music. ZSNES doesn't emulate release values of ADSR so held notes will sound poor. [[File: Old zsnes snow gui.jpg|left|thumb|300px|Despite being outclassed by many more accurate ''and secure'' emulators, some held on to Zsnes for its iconic user interface.]] * Many of the co-processors, which are actually on the game cartridges, are emulated in strange ways. For example, Super FX is not clocked correctly; Star Fox runs twice as fast as it should. * Transparency: Kirby Dreamland 3, Mecarobot Golf, Jurassic Park and other games that use pseudo-hi-res translucency won't display correctly in the default graphics engine in v1.51. ==Download=ZMZ===[http://www.smwcentral.net/?p=section&a=details&id=5681 ZMZ] isn't an emulator in its own right, rather it takes the interface that ZSNES uses and applies it to a [[libretro]] frontend for running SNES cores such as [[Snes9x]] and [[bsnes]]. Apart from the replicated ZSNES interface, it can also record ZMV files. ===ZSNES 2===* [https://github.com/xyproto/zsnes An active fork of ZSNES on GitHub.] It is primarily focused on allowing ZSNES to be compiled on x64 versions of modern Linux distros.
